St. Karen Dolan

Recent stories and letters in The Morning Call have portrayed Karen Dolan, who has left Bethlehem in disgrace, as a saint. But Angelo Fetter, President of Monocacy Field and Stream, tells a different tale.

Every year since 1933, his nonprofit sponsors fishing tournaments for children. At one time, when they had more money, they would have fishing events for the blind and disabled as well. It was during the 2012 tournament that he drew the ire of Karen Dolan. "This lady made life hell for us," he claims.

In 2012, the tournament was right next to the Falls, and was offering free hot dogs and hamburgers to the kids and everyone else. But unfortunately for him, it was on a day when Dolan was hosting one of her artsy-fartsy wine-tasting events at the Mill, including a Take-a -Taco truck there to sell its fare.

People weren't buying her food because they were getting free hot dogs and hamburgers, and she went ballistic.

She cut power to the hot plates and grills. "You're not paying the electricity bill here. I am," she told him, although it would later be learned that Bethlehem was actually paying that bill.

The following year, when Fetter scheduled the tournament, he had to get 11 permits. "Never in the 14 years I was doing this was i required to get a permit before," Fetter noted.

When Fetter approached her to protest, she put her hand up in the air and said she had no time for him.

After months of debate, Pennsylvania Fish and Boat Commissioners approved a change to their Class A wild trout stream policy.

Class As are the best of the best among wild trout fisheries. Typically, they are never stocked.

There are 10 stream sections across the state that are home to Class A populations and among the most heavily used stocked trout streams in the state, however. Agency staff has been wrestling with how to handle that. Lawmakers and anglers have argued for stocking to continue; biologists have been seeking to have the streams classified as Class A to give them additional protection.

“It's a very politically charged situation,” said Leroy Young, director of the commission's bureau of fisheries.

The board arrived at a compromise at its most recent meeting. It agreed to allow the stocking of Class A streams only with the approval of the board. The 10 stream sections in question likely will be voted on that way as early as January.

The streams are Fishing Creek in Clinton County; two sections of Little Lehigh Creek in Lehigh County, Martins Creek and two sections of Monocacy Creek in Northamption County, Penns Creek in Centre County, two sections of Yellow Creek in Bedford County, and Pohopoco Creek in Carbon County.
